Install Zabbix Agent to Monitor Windows and Linux Hosts

13 October 20215 April 2020 by David

At the end of my previous article we had a functioning Zabbix server set up to monitor itself. To monitor other hosts, we will need to tell Zabbix about other devices on your network. The two main ways Zabbix can monitor a host are via an agent installed on the host or via SNMP. Generally … Read more
